Lawrence M. Ward 《Attention, perception & psychophysics》1973,14(2):337-342
Twelve Ss made binary decisions with feedback on numbers from one of two normal distributions with equal variances and unequal means. Sequences of distribution choices corresponded to first-order two-state Markov processes with probabilities of change of state of p1 = p2 = .50, p1 = p2 = .75, and p1 = p2 = .25. Performance was best (in d’ terms) when p1 = p2 ≠ .50. First-order sequential response dependencies tended to mirror the first-order stimulus dependencies. Violations of a fixed cutoff point decision rule were concentrated in the region of the average critical point, with a bandwidth of about 1/2σ, in which violations were strikingly more frequent than would be expected if they had occurred randomly. These results imply that in this task Ss are using a criterion-band decision rule instead of a fixed cutoff point rule, and that they are basing decisions in the region of the criterion band on information extracted from the sequence of decisions presented to them. The average bandwidth is generally different from the optimum bandwidth used by an ideal O in combining the two sources of information. 相似文献

Consistent relationships are found between Ss′ absolute judgments of the value of a stimulus and the previous sequence of both stimuli and responses. The form and magnitude of these sequential effects are shown to depend on the presence or absence of feedback and on task difficulty. The pattern of the sequential effects found allows the conclusion that they are due to purely response-system processes. A two-stage model of the judgment process is proposed, and it is argued that observed assimilative effects account for the central tendency effects observed in category judgments. 相似文献

Teachers were trained in the systematic use of attention and praise to reduce the disruptive classroom behavior of four first-grade children. Observation measures showed a significant improvement from baseline to treatment for these children and no significant changes for same-class controls. While the amount of teacher attention to target children remained the same from baseline to treatment, the proportion of attention to task-relevant behavior of these children increased. Psychological tests revealed no adverse changes after treatment. 相似文献

Joy S. Kaufman Christian M. Connell Cindy A. Crusto Derrick M. Gordon Carolyn E. Sartor Patricia Simon Michael J. Strambler Tami P. Sullivan Nadia L. Ward Nicole Holland Weiss Jacob Kraemer Tebes 《American journal of community psychology》2016,58(3-4):348-353
The 50th anniversary of the Swampscott Conference offers an opportunity to reflect on a community psychology setting, The Consultation Center at Yale, that was formed in response to the 1963 Community Mental Health Act and the 1965 Swampscott Conference. The Center has flourished as a community psychology setting for practice, research, and training for 39 of the 50 years since Swampscott. Its creation and existence over this period offers an opportunity for reflection on the types of settings needed to sustain the field into the future. 相似文献

The human brain represents different kinds of visual feature dimensions in different ways. For example, surface features exhibit some properties that are very different from contour features, and some feature dimensions may be represented more extensively in either the dorsal or the ventral visual stream. Given such differences, we investigated feature binding across different feature dimensions and whether some feature dimensions might be more easily bound together than others. In Experiment 1, we looked at cross-dimension bindings for all combinations of color, orientation, and shape dimensions, while at the same time controlling for feature discriminability. Rates of correct binding, illusory conjunctions, and feature errors were equivalent in all cases. There was no bias so that some feature dimensions were easier to combine than others. In Experiment 2, we manipulated the difficulty of feature discrimination for the key, target-defining feature and the report feature. Rates of binding errors increased with difficulty of the key feature, but not with that of the report feature. The accuracy of feature discrimination could be dissociated from the accuracy of binding the feature to an object. Across both experiments, the accuracy of feature binding was independent of specific feature dimensions or perceptibility. These findings are discussed in relation to both feature integration and multiple-stage accounts of visual feature integration. 相似文献
